Waste Tire Collection Centers

In the six counties of the Northwest Arkansas Regional Solid Waste Management District, approximately 140,000 waste tires are generated each year.  This equates to about one tire per person per year.

Citizens of this Region are allowed to bring in a limited number of waste tires for free
disposal to any of the permitted Waste Tire Collection Centers on the following table.
